**Ticket: Config drift on fd-hunt tooling (Ostrel fleet)**

Support: the leaked-file-descriptor hunt on the Ostrel ingest fleet is producing inconsistent results because three hosts drifted from the baseline. The fd sampler on those hosts runs with an old polling interval and a smaller descriptor cap, so leak counts look artificially low there. Do not compare graphs across hosts until drift is fixed. Re-apply the baseline from the config repo and restart the sampler. For reference, the intended configuration values are listed below.

deployment values, kajog-kajep:
[briwyn]
team = holix
access_code = ac_8d066e
owner = gilix.quenion
host = briwyn.zemvardyn.internal
port = 4000
peer = juldor.ferralabs.internal
salt = 1f7475b6
pin = 1838

# Pricegate Experiment Environments

The Pricegate ticket-pricing experiment runs in three environments: sandbox, canary, and live. Each applies different fare multipliers and rollout percentages, so never copy settings across them blindly. Maintainers should note that canary shares its database with live but not its feature flags. For reference, the canary environment currently runs with the following configuration.

deployment values, tafof-taduf:
pelius:
  pin: 6508
  tenant: praiel
  seal: seal_4e33a2f4
  metrics_host: metrics.pelius.plorvagrid.corp
  standby_team: druix
  escalation: juldor-norius
  nonce: 5db598

Welcome aboard! Quick primer before Thursday's review. The old scheme at Varnholt Supply paid flat 4% on everything, which meant reps pushed easy renewals and ignored the Corvane product line entirely. The new plan tiers commissions: 3% on renewals, 6% on new logos, and an 8% kicker on Corvane deals over threshold. Pilot results from the Dunmere branch look promising — new-logo volume up a third. Marek will walk through the payout modelling. The strategic rationale we'll share with you privately is noted below.

management briefing: Headcount on the Quenael team goes from 9 to 80 by the end of July. Gross margin on Quenael came in at 15 percent against a plan of 20 percent.